An opportunity for part-time, paid, orienteering-related work.
GMOA is looking for a group of people who will be able to develop and extend the work that the current post-watchers do. Post-watchers may be ideal candidates but this is a much wider brief.
We want to keep all our POCs up-to-date, usable and useful, and are trying to make the workload involved more manageable by getting more people involved.
The responsibilities will be:
- Carry out a comprehensive review of the courses planned in an area or group of areas on a yearly, or maybe two-yearly basis.
- Document each review using the attached template (GMOA_POC_Review_v1.6.doc). This shows all the different aspects of our systems that need to be kept up-to-date.
- Keep in contact with the local authority or group responsible for the upkeep of an area
Each review will require at least one site visit, and a number of phone calls and/or email contacts – some of these could cover multiple parks at the same time. For example, it would be possible for one individual to cover all parks in a Borough. Payment will be made for each park and will vary according to size and complexity.
Where a Review identifies issues, the Committee will decide how to sort them out – this role is about identifying issues not solving them.
